
👩🍳 Instructions
- Mix the base:
- In a bowl, mash the cottage cheese with a fork until fairly smooth.
- Add softened butter and mix until creamy.
- Season:
- Stir in finely chopped onion, paprika, caraway (if using), salt, and pepper.
- Add sour cream if you’d like it extra smooth and spreadable.
- Chill:
- Let rest in the fridge for at least 30 minutes so the flavors can meld.

💡 Tips
- For a rustic version, leave the texture slightly chunky.
- Want it spicy? Add a pinch of hot paprika or a touch of mustard.
- Traditional in Transylvania and rural Hungary, Körözött is also popular in Slovakia and Austria with regional twists.
